Wing boasts proud lineage

The 67th Network Warfare Wing and its predecessors have a long, distinguished service record.

The mission of the wing is to execute Air Force network operations, defense, attack and exploitation to create integrated cyberspace effects for the Air Force Network Operations commander and combatant commands.

Lineage

Nov. 6, 1947 -- Established as 67th Reconnaissance Wing

Nov. 25, 1947 -- Organized as 67th RW at March Field (later Air Force Base), Calif. Assigned to Twelfth Air Force until Dec. 20, 1948 and attached to 1st Fighter Wing.

Aug. 22, 1948 -- Redesignated 67th Tactical Reconnaissance Wing, assigned to Fourth Air Force, and remained attached to 1st FW. Inactivated March 28, 1949 at March Field.

Feb. 25, 1951 -- Activated at Komaki Air Base, Japan, with assignment to Fifth Air Force. On March 21, moved to Taegu AB, South Korea and then moved to Kimpo AB, South Korea Aug. 20, 1951.

Dec. 6, 1954 -- Moved to Itami AB, Japan

July 1, 1957 -- Moved to Yokota AB, Japan

Nov. 10, 1958 -- Assigned to 41st Air Division

Dec. 8, 1960 -- Discontinued and inactivated at Yokota AB

Aug. 2, 1965 -- Activated with assignment to Tactical Air Command.

Jan 1, 1966 -- Organized at Mountain Home AFB, Idaho with assignment to Twelfth Air Force.

April 15, 1966 -- Assigned to 831st Air Division

July 15, 1971-- Moved to Bergstrom AFB, Texas

Oct. 1, 1991 -- Redesignated 67th Reconnaissance Wing with assignment to Twelfth Air Force

Sept. 30, 1993 -- Inactivated at Bergstrom AFB

Oct. 1, 1993 -- Activated and redesignated 67th Intelligence Wing at Kelly Air Force Base, Texas, with assignment to Air Intelligence Agency

Aug. 1, 2000 -- Redesignated 67th Information Operations Wing

Feb. 1, 2001 -- Assigned to Eighth Air Force

July 5, 2006 -- Redesignated 67th Network Warfare Wing

Bestowed Honors - authorized to display honors earned before Nov. 25, 1947
World War II Campaign Streamers before Nov. 25, 1947
World War II: Antisubmarine, American Theater
European-African-Middle Eastern: Air Offensive Europe
Normandy
Northern France
Rhineland
Ardennes-Alsace
Central Europe
Air Combat, European-African-Middle Eastern Theater

Decorations before Nov. 25, 1947
Distinguished Unit Citation: Le Havre and Straits of Dover, Feb. 15 to March 20, 1944
Belgian Fourragere: Citations in the Order of the Day, Belgian Army: June 6 through Sept. 1944 and Dec. 16 through Jan. 25, 1945
